How much do electrical engineer embedded systems jobs pay per year?

As of May 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for electrical engineer embedded systems in the United States is $111,091.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,000.00 and $132,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Electrical Engineer Embedded Systems do?

An Electrical Engineer in Embedded Systems designs, develops, and tests hardware and firmware for embedded devices. They work with microcontrollers, processors, sensors, and communication interfaces to create efficient and reliable systems. Their responsibilities often include circuit design, PCB layout, firmware development, and debugging. They collaborate with software engineers and other team members to ensure seamless integration of hardware and software.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Electrical Engineer Embedded Systems position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Electrical Engineer Embedded Systems, you need a strong background in electrical engineering, embedded system design, C/C++ programming, and microcontroller/microprocessor integration, typically sup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with industry-standard tools such as MATLAB, Altium Designer, oscilloscopes, and debuggers, as well as knowledge of RTOS or Linux, and certifications like Certified Embedded Systems Engineer, are often expected. Strong probl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ective teamwork and communication skills set top performers apart in this field. These competencies ensure reliable, innovative embedded systems development and smooth collaboration within multidisciplinary engineering teams.

What are the typical daily tasks and team dynamics for an Electrical Engineer Embedded Systems?

On a typical day, an Electrical Engineer Embedded Systems might design, develop, and test embedded hardware and software, troubleshoot integration issues, and document technical specifications. You’ll often collaborate closely with software engineers, PCB designers, and project managers to ensure your solutions align with overall project goals. The role may involve both independent work and group brainstorming sessions, depending on the project phase. Effective communication within a cross-functional team is key to resolving challenges quickly and delivering high-quality embedded systems products.
